Biography

Nicole Forto, 17, began running dogs with her Mom and Dad when she was three. She says her family moved here from Colorado to pursue their mushing dreams. “Team Ineka is named after the best dog ever on our team, Ineka, who passed away right before we moved to Alaska. “ She said she felt him saying, “I did my job, now you do yours.” Nicole won the Red Lantern in the 2014 Jr. Iditarod. She is a senior at Houston High School where she participates in softball. When asked what else she enjoys, she responds, “Softball and dogs all day long!” She also says she enjoys music and researching marine biology facts. After graduation, she plans to attend the University of Alaska/Southeast and study Marine Biology. She expects to continue running dogs when she is home from college.
